Understanding Convolutional Neural Community Cnn Architecture

For example, in cancer detection, a excessive efficiency is essential because the better the efficiency is the extra individuals can be treated. However there are additionally Machine Studying problems where a conventional algorithm delivers a greater than satisfying end result. These algorithms are designed to recognize preferences and depart the unimportant ones to determine the output. These preferences can differ at completely different times leading to a unique choice. A computer-dependent determination relies on a fraction of essential qualities/values/requirements at a given time.

Data Engineer Vs Knowledge Scientist – How Do They Differ?

With their coaching, ANNs turn into adept at recognizing spoken words and effortlessly translating textual content between various languages. In ANNs, information is handed via a sequence of layers of nodes, with every layer processing the info another way. The outputs of one layer are then used because the inputs for the subsequent layer, with this course of continuing until the final layer produces the output of the ANN. These models can solely carry out focused duties, i.e., process information on which they are skilled. For occasion, a model educated on classifying cats and canines will not classify men and women.

Complex Algorithms Are Foreseen Disadvantages Of Neural Networks

Due to its complicated nature, there are several disadvantages of Neural Networks that need to rectified. Earlier Than you’ll find a way to absolutely grasp the capabilities of a random forest algorithm, it helps to grasp how a choice tree works. A choice tree is an algorithm that starts with an input and asks branching yes or no inquiries to broaden its understanding and make a decision primarily based on the information.

Pros and cons of neural networks

The concept of world generalization is that all the parameters within the model ought to cohesively replace themselves to scale back the generalization error or check what can neural networks do error as much as potential. However, because of the complexity of the mannequin, it is extremely troublesome to attain zero generalization error on the take a look at set. Check out 15+ High Pc Vision Project Ideas for Novices to begin constructing your personal fashions. Once the training is completed, V7 will notify you through email that your mannequin has finished training and is ready to use. Choose the Model card and click ‘Continue’ which can take you to the subsequent page to pick your dataset for training. Let us briefly walk you thru the coaching of the occasion segmentation model.

LSTM is capable of learning long-term dependencies, especially in sequence prediction problems. This community has feedback connections and might process the complete sequence of knowledge and particular person information points. LSTM neural networks are in a position to project time sequence to the future based mostly on what occurred up to now. Its primary purposes are speech, handwriting recognition and modeling predictions. A neural community consists of a collection of nodes that include an input layer, a number of hidden layers and an output layer.

How Do Convolutional Neural Community Models Work?

Pros and cons of neural networks

Let’s evaluate the principle features and purposes of the previously named neural network architectures. These are knowledge, computational energy, the algorithms itself and advertising. As far as the researchers are concerned, the machines capable of undertaking duties mechanically, halting operations, and detecting security dangers are required to be designed. This will ease the job for humans, making it an automatic appointment. The applications can be limitless and may have various execs and cons.

Pros and cons of neural networks

Tips On How To Create And Practice Deep Studying Models

In addition, as a end result of the input is stored in its own networks somewhat than a database, it doesn’t endure from data loss. Unlike humans, a machine would not get tired if it runs inside well-specified limits. Additionally, it may possibly work repeatedly, saving plenty of time producing extra remarkable results. If programmed accurately, a machine can complete a task quickly, which can take humans longer hours. While the responses and interpretation are quick, information storage is unlimited in the computer-based mode of operation.

The modular neural community consists of a quantity of independently functioning networks monitored by some intermediary. Every community serves as a module and operates on a singular set of inputs. Large and complex processes are cut up into multiple impartial parts, and each part is assigned to a single network or module. After that, the pooling stage reduces every feature’s dimensions to maintain useful information. The final step analyzes possibilities and decides the category of an image.

The convolutional layer applies the ReLU activation function to every function map to convert non-negative values to zero. Deep learning algorithms can help to search out anomalies which would possibly be unseen to the naked eye. Algorithms just like the Hierarchical Probabilistic U-Net by Google’s DeepMind is one such instance that is able to find tumor cells in medical images. Such algorithms are discovered to be a fantastic software for radiologists and docs. These fashions are so complicated that a traditional CPU will be unable to resist the computational complexity.

The more amount of information is used throughout training, the more accurate the outcomes are. Dependency on knowledge https://deveducation.com/ is doubtless considered one of the main disadvantages of Neural Networks, as some should be on the upkeep facet to observe it. Since there are errors in the data, the result might be faulty, which poses severe threats. All the programming wanted to be done initially requires prolonged and complicated applications to be written. For instance, it may require months to create an algorithm able to working a specified task.

  • Deep learning algorithms use a layered structure, the place the input information is passed by way of an input layer and then propagated by way of multiple hidden layers, before reaching the output layer.
  • In a CNN model, there may be any variety of convolutional and pooling layers.
  • As in all circumstances, synthetic neural networks also have limitations that don’t enable its use in varied instances.
  • It is predicated on the thought of building synthetic neural networks with multiple layers, called deep neural networks, that can study hierarchical representations of the info.
  • This is because they require a lot of data, and the training process could be time-consuming.
  • Now you understand that Neural networks are great for some tasks but not as nice for others.

The software of AI in healthcare has shown significant potential in enhancing patient outcomes, streamlining processes, and enhancing decision-making. Here, we explore a quantity of key applications of AI algorithms in real-world healthcare situations. In summary, the combination of synthetic intelligence into algorithms presents a mess of advantages that can considerably enhance each scientific analysis and enterprise operations. By leveraging AI’s capabilities, organizations can obtain greater efficiency, make knowledgeable selections, and drive innovation.

This is likely one of the greatest advantages of this idea as it might possibly simply modify with any group of execs aiming to work with it. The last benefit among others is that they painting a user-friendly interface. For any machine or synthetic tools to turn into successful, its interface and usefulness of it should be user-friendly.

Leave a Reply

Your email address will not be published. Required fields are marked *